Nexus Core Systems Announces Plans for AI Factory in Morocco Using 500 MW Renewable Energy
Nexus Core Systems to Establish AI Factory in Morocco
In a monumental advancement for artificial intelligence infrastructure, Nexus Core Systems has announced its plans to build a state-of-the-art AI factory in Morocco. Supported by a global consortium that includes Lloyds Capital, NAVER Cloud, and Maroc Telecom, this ambitious endeavor marks a turning point in the country's industrial capabilities as it moves toward AI and robotics integration.
Geographical Advantage of Morocco
Strategically located just 15 kilometers from Europe and connected by multiple subsea fiber corridors, Morocco is set to provide a unique advantage in delivering sovereign compute capacity to European markets. The proposed AI facility will not only cater to local demands but also enhance cross-border capabilities, thereby positioning Morocco as a key player in the AI domain.
Advanced Infrastructure Development
The project plans to leverage cutting-edge accelerated computing, networking, and AI-native infrastructure, ensuring that it meets the high demands of modern AI applications. The data centers will be constructed using modular infrastructure technology, which allows for rapid deployment, scalable growth, and efficient maintenance, significantly reducing construction risks and minimizing the need for on-site labor.
The initial phase, slated for launch in Q1 of 2026, will feature over 40 MW of next-generation AI accelerators, making it one of the largest AI supercomputers in the region. The entire facility will be powered by a strategic agreement with TAQA Morocco, facilitating up to 500 MW of renewable energy to ensure sustainable and cost-effective operations.
Collaborative Efforts for Market Deployment
In collaboration with Nexus, NAVER Cloud plans to deploy its proprietary hyperscale cloud platform, featuring the CLOVA AI suite. This platform prioritizes a zero-trust security architecture alongside stringent data residency controls that comply with the legal frameworks governing data sovereignty across the EMEA region. Maroc Telecom will act as the principal go-to-market partner, spearheading distribution efforts within the public and enterprise sectors.
